Bug Description
[Impact]
In utopic more c32 files need linking to ensure live-build can come up with a working syslinux installation. Without the additional links live-build and thus ubuntu-
This does not affect ubuntu-cdimage as that one copies specific c32s manually.
The fix for this problem is to link all c32s ubuntu-cdimage copies.
